5 Troubleshooting the Blower
Best practice
The best practice when troubleshooting this system is to:
1. Isolate and check each component of this system individually.
2. When a malfunctioning component is found, repair or replace it.
3. After replacing a malfunctioning component, retry system operation.
This chapter provides procedures to check the components.
Sequence
When troubleshooting the blower, do so in the following sequence.
Step Task See Topic
1. Check the fuse. 5.1
2. Check power to/from the control board. 5.2
3. Check the ON-OFF switch. 5.3
4. Check the capacitor. 5.4
WARNING
Electric shock hazard. Some tests require measuring live, high voltages. Electric
shock can cause severe injury or death.
f Use extreme care and appropriate arc flash avoidance techniques when mea-
suring live, high voltages.
